One policy that John F. Kennedy and Richard Nixon had in common was their commitment to the continuation of the Cold War and the containment of communism. Both presidents were determined to confront and oppose the spread of communism globally, resulting in policies such as the Bay of Pigs invasion and the Vietnam War during their respective administrations.

Who was John F. Kennedy s opponent in the 1960 presidential election?

John F. Kennedy won the 1960 presidential election defeating Richard Nixon. In the 1960 presidential election John F. Kennedy received 303 electoral votes, Richard Nixon received 219 electoral votes, and Harry Byrd received 15 electoral votes. The popular vote totals were Kennedy 34,226,731 and Nixon 34,108,157.
